Give users the easiest path: "Click [URL]."

Btw, "open" is a figure of speech for output---you can open a can
or a door, but not an URL.
And by giving them a link to the URL, they have access. :-)

A trick that helps with such problems is asking what the user is
trying to make. To do so , consider Aristotle's four causes,
if the example were a marble statue:
- material cause: marble (The result is made of what?)
- formal cause: the model posing for the statue (The result is made to look like who?)
- efficient cause: hammer & chisel (The result is made how?)
- final cause: payment for finishing the statue. (The result is made why?)

Focus on the efficient cause, by answering the question "How?",
rather than the material cause---the computer implementation, HTML...

Sad Fact
=> A user can only click [to select, to enable, to use], type, scroll, read,
and very little else.
All the other verbs---go, visit, surf, access, run, draw---are highly metaphorical;
at best they give a specialized audience an analogy of some formal cause;
at worst they are ambiguous. Ask the localizers.
